Book Introduction
The reason many students have difficulty reading (non-fiction) is because they are exposed to boring material and difficult texts that do not match their level.
『Zistory Middle School Korean Reading Comprehension Completion』 is divided into reading passages by level and is structured to help readers improve their reading comprehension in a step-by-step manner. By having fun studying with the latest issues and interesting passages and improving your Korean reading comprehension, you can improve your grades in all subjects. |

[Problem] Features
1.
24 days of learning with 2 passages per day: We've made studying fun with passages that contain interesting material and practical vocabulary.
2.
The entire book is divided into STEP 1: Finding keywords, finding the central sentence, STEP 2: Summarizing paragraphs, understanding the relationship between paragraphs, and STEP 3: Understanding the structure of the text, finding the topic, so that you can systematically build your reading comprehension skills.
3.
We have provided a personal tutor, Follow Me, to help you easily understand the text, and provided guidance on how to approach the text at each step.
4.
We have designed a variety of questions to help you assess whether you have read the text well, including content comprehension questions, content inference questions, and vocabulary questions.
5.
We provide a variety of background information related to the text to help you build your vocabulary and broaden your background knowledge through various types of vocabulary tests every day.
[Commentary] Features
1.
The entire text is included in the commentary, and the basis for each choice is indicated in the text.
In addition, we have included the full text of the question and provided explanations for the answer choices so that you can understand at a glance why the answer is correct or incorrect.
2.
We summarize the content of each paragraph and display the keywords and central sentences of each paragraph and the central sentence of the entire text to help you quickly understand the content of the text.
3.
We have provided a breakdown of the content, topics, relationships between paragraphs, and a structure diagram of the text to help readers fully understand the content of the text.
4.
By asking 'Why is it correct?' and 'Why is it wrong?', we provide the basis for the correct and incorrect answers, thereby increasing understanding of the problem.
